Abstract

Earnings persistence is one component of earnings quality. Earnings persistence is a measure that explains the company's ability to maintain the current amount of profit into the future. Profits of companies that are able to survive in the future will reflect quality profits. The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of leverage, cash flow accruals, sales volatility, and size of company on earnings persistence. The population used in this study were various industrial sector manufacturing compan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ange, with the determination of the sample using purposive sampling in order to obtain 23 companies. The results showed that the leverage variable does not have a significant effect on earnings persistence. Accruals cash flow has a significant effect on earnings persistence. Sales volatility has no significant effect on earnings persistence. Size of Company has no significant effect on earnings persistence. The coefficient of determination (Adjusted R Square) is 0.259, this means that the variable leverage, cash flow accruals, sales volatility, size of company has a role of 25.9%. With a determination coefficient of 25.9%, it is expected that the company will be able to present financial reports that reflect the quality of earnings so that it can become a reference for potential investors / investors in investing
